2007 Chrysler 300 Stuck in Park

2007 CHRYSLER 300
59,000 MILES • 5.4L • V8 • 2WD • AUTOMATIC

Car has been normal, I used the remote start and car will not shift out of park. I turned car off and started normal and still will not shift out of park. I disconnected the car 12V battery from + & - and car starts as normal, but will not shift. I push on my breaks and shifter moves a little, If I do not push on the break the shifter moves less.

The park lock solenoid is powered by the brake light switch. When you push on the brake and the brake lights turn on, power is also sent to the solenoid to release the shifter. First, check to make sure the brake lights are working. If they aren't, check fuses and check the brake light switch. If they are working, you need to access the park release solenoid and check if it is getting power. If it is, then the solenoid needs replaced. If there is no power, you will have to trace the power supply back to the brake light switch to see where power is lost.
